Definition of fool


  • a person who lacks good judgment (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. muggins
    2. sap
    3. saphead
    4. tomfool
  • fool or hoax (verb)

    Examples

    1. You can't fool me!

    Synonyms

    1. befool
    2. cod
    3. dupe
    4. gull
    5. put on
    6. put one across
    7. put one over
    8. slang
    9. take in
  • a professional clown employed to entertain a king or nobleman in the Middle Ages (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. jester
    2. motley fool
  • spend frivolously and unwisely (verb)

    Synonyms

    1. dissipate
    2. fool away
    3. fritter
    4. fritter away
    5. frivol away
    6. shoot
  • a person who is gullible and easy to take advantage of (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. chump
    2. fall guy
    3. gull
    4. mark
    5. mug
    6. patsy
    7. soft touch
    8. sucker
  • indulge in horseplay (verb)

    Examples

    1. The bored children were fooling about

    Synonyms

    1. arse around
    2. fool around
    3. horse around
  • make a fool or dupe of (verb)

    Synonyms

    1. befool
    2. gull
